And any advice about the Glory. I did a B2B on the Glory in November 2014. I had the same cabin for both legs of the cruise which made it very simple, no need to pack your bags at the end of the first week. On the last night of the first week you should receive a letter in your cabin explaining the process the next morning. Usually it will tell you to meet in the main lobby at about 10:30, after all the rest of the passengers have left the ship one of the crew members will walk you off the ship to go thru customs. All you need to take is your passport and your customs form. Then the crew member will take you back on board, give you a new sign and sail card for week two, usually offer you a free glass of champagne, take a group picture with the other B2B people and then you are free to enjoy the empty ship for about and hour. Its great to watch everybody else get off the ship knowing you get to stay on for another week. Any other question, let me know. Tom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

I would definitely recommend doing a back to back if you can, in fact I am doing another B2B on the Glory this November. You will get a new cabin key and new sign and sail account after the first week. If you are 5 points away from being Platinum right now before your cruise, I believe that you will have Platinum status at the beginning of your first week. If you check your cruise documents online it should indicate what level you will be at when you board the ship.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
